University of Idaho
Working on the further improvement of a liquid plasma discharge device and method for biodiesel synthesis using SAME (Patent No. WO2017132242A1): This technology revolutionizes the traditional batch design of the fermenter and features much smaller reactor size with no bulk storage needed, fast reaction (<1 second reaction time vs. hours).
Developed and optimized the process for high quality ethyl and methyl ester (Biodiesel) from triglycerides in the presence of sodium ethoxide and sodium methoxide in LPPD reactor respectively.
Understanding the role of electron density and solution conductivity mechanism involve in fast and advanced conversion of Triglycerides and Fats.
Developing a new Biofuel conversion processes for different 2nd and 3rd generation Biofuel feedstocks.
Industry project; High FFA content corn oil to produce biodiesel. We have used ethanol (90-95%) with sulphuric acid for esterification by plasma reaction and FFA reduced oil with sodium ethoxide for transesterification.
Liquid plasma to pretreat lignocellulosic biomass to produce biofuel and different organic compounds.
Projects assisting: Develop and evaluate an electrolytic reactor equipped with an anodic magnesium plate to produce struvite from the effluent of the anaerobic digester to remove both nitrogen and phosphorus.
Per fluorinated Alkyl Substances (PFAS) degradation in novel liquid phase plasma discharge reactor.
